Expert reviewers hailed the Logitech ERGO K860 for its exceptional ergonomics and its fast Bluetooth 5.0 connectivity. Suppose you’ve gone through our Logitech Combo Touch review or our Logitech Folio touch review. In that case, you’ll realize that Bluetooth connectivity is not as common for detachable keyboards. This is partly why testers from Rtings highlighted the K860’s Bluetooth capabilities during their tests. They were glad that it could pair with up to three devices and that the K860 has multi-platform compatibility. During their experiments, they found its typing noise to be quite low and that they did not have to fuss with wires since it is wireless.

However, the testing team at PC Mag was not pleased with the K860’s lack of backlighting and felt that the keyboard took up a lot of desk space due to its large size (it measures 17.9 inches by 9.3 inches). They also decried its high 26.4ms latency and its inability to map keys to different functions.

Overview

Launched in early 2020, the Logitech Ergo K860 is a mid-tier wireless split keyboard that comes with a distinctive up-curve that is rare to find even among the best keyboards on the market. The keyboard is of good build quality and comes with a wrist rest that feels quite comfortable to use while also preventing muscle strain. The K860 also features two incline settings for owners to choose from and has a total of 109 keys.

Its curved keyboard design may take just as much time to get used to as the split keyboard on the Kinesis Freestyle Pro (which we covered in our Kinesis Freestyle Pro review), but its wireless connectivity is excellent since users will be able to connect it to a computer through either its USB receiver or Bluetooth.
